A musty smell in the basement or crawl space is usually moisture you can't see yet, not just "old house smell."
Hairline cracks can widen over a Pullman winter's freeze-thaw cycle and become active leak points by spring.
That white chalky film on basement walls is efflorescence — mineral deposits left behind as water evaporates through concrete.
If your pump is running around the clock instead of only during storms, it's worth having it evaluated before it fails completely.
This is one sign we tell Pullman customers not to wait on — wall movement tends to progress rather than resolve on its own.
Peeling paint low on a basement wall or warped baseboards upstairs often trace back to moisture migrating up from below.
